Description5a-Pregnane-320-dione is a biologically active 5-alpha-reduced metabolite of plasma progesterone.
-
In Vitro5a-Pregnane-3,20-dione decreases cell-substrate attachment, adhesion plaques, vinculin expression, and polymerizes F-actin in MCF-7 breast cancer cells.
